1. Weight and Thickness
The weight of paper, typically measured in grams per square meter (GSM), affects its thickness, quality, and sturdiness. Lighter documents (70-80 GSM) are generally more affordable and suitable for routine tasks, while much heavier documents (90-120 GSM) are perfect for expert files and discussions.
2. Brightness
The brightness of paper impacts the contrast of printed texts and images. A greater brightness level (measured as a portion) leads to better exposure and sharper colors. For general workplace usage, a brightness level of 90% or greater is recommended.

5. Compatibility with Printers
It's necessary to think about the kind of printers used in the workplace. Some paper types work much better with inkjet printers, while others are created for laser printers. Ensuring compatibility can avoid paper jams and printing mistakes.

Proper storage and handling of copy paper can prevent damage and keep quality. Consider the following pointers:
Store Flat: Keep paper in a flat position to avoid curling and warping.Avoid Humidity: Store paper in a cool, dry environment to avoid wetness absorption, which can cause paper jams.Keep Away from Direct Sunlight: Exposure to light can trigger fading and deterioration of paper quality.Examine Expiration Dates: While paper does not technically expire, using paper that has been saved incorrectly can lead to compromised quality.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What is the finest weight for daily printing?
For everyday printing, basic copy paper weighing in between 70-80 GSM is normally sufficient. It is affordable and appropriate for most workplace requirements.
2. Can I use colored copy paper in a laser printer?
Yes, colored copy paper can be utilized in laser printers, however it's necessary to validate compatibility ahead of time. Always inspect the paper's requirements or speak with the printer's manual for finest results.

4. Is recycled paper as good as virgin paper?
Recycled paper quality varies by brand and manufacturing procedure. Premium recycled papers can perform comparably to virgin paper, but businesses should consider specific requirements and conduct tests to ensure quality.
